Open Classes

Siamese/Balinese/Pointed Bicolour Imperial Grand Premier, Male

Thanks to the exhibitors for putting these cats under me. Good to see three cats all of whom in my opinion deserved the highest award, even if only one could win it. None of them perfect (what perfect cat has there ever been, anyway) but with their little flaws vanishing into insignificance against their overall quality.
OGPC Tobias's IMP GR PR SHERMESE FUNANDGAMES (32/1) 9 Sep 06
An extremely handsome mature lad of excellent type. Strong long even wedge, good width at the top, large ear very well set. Straight profile, deep chin but it could really be a little firmer, level bite with only one lower incisor. Expressive eyes of excellent shape and set and very good depth of blue. Long muscular body, long legs with large paws, tail needs an extra inch to balance. His markings in a good warm seal are adequate but not outstanding, which given that he is ticked based is the best one can expect - the "M" is a little blurred, and the tail half ringed. Moderately shaded body, coat close though a little harsh in texture. A friendly lad who handled well, but in his pen wanted to be under every available blanket. Excellent presentation.
Res OGPC Hutchings's IMP GR PR MAFDET MACATHUR (32/8) 23 Apr 09
A handsome lad of excellent type, his head nearly as good as the winner, but his body still needing to catch up. Long even wedge, good width at the top, well set large ears. Straight profile, firm chin and level bite. Eyes of good shape and set if a little deep set, of a very good depth of blue. Longish firm body needing more muscle ideally, long legs with neat paws, tail needs at least an extra inch to balance. Well marked in a good lilac-based caramel with a generous overlay of sludgy overtones: good facial markings (unsurprisingly, no thumbprints), leg bars present even if faint, fully ringed tail. Unshaded body, coat close but the texture a little harsh along the spine. A little shy, excellent presentation.
Also considered Janicki's IMP GR PR SHERMESE FABULOUS FABERGE (24) 10 Feb 09
Another handsome lad of excellent type, and presenting me with a real dilemma as to the reserve. Long wedge, a little overlong in the muzzle, good width at the top, well set large ears. Straight profile, firm deep chin, level bite lacking central lower incisors. Eyes of very good shape and set and good depth of blue. Long muscular but lean body - unusually for a neuter, some more weight would improve him. Long legs with neat paws, tail needs an extra fraction. Very good warm seal points, moderately shaded body but still good contrast and good warmth to the body colour. Coat short, close-lying and of excellent texture. Very shy, needing a bit of extra self-belief, excellent presentation.

Siamese/Balinese Grand Champion, Male

1 (IGCC N/A) Single's GR CH HARTZIE ARCTIC ECHO (24b) 20 Aug 10
A lad of good type. Longish even wedge, good width at the top, well set large ears. Small dip in profile, firm chin and level bite. Eyes of very good shape and set and very good depth of blue. Long firm body, long legs with neat paws, tail needs an extra fraction to balance. Points a good warm chocolate but the mask incomplete with pale whisker pads and all points rather brindled, unusually for his colour distinct ghost tabby markings to head and tail. Lightly shaded body, coat a little long and slightly harsh in texture along the back, signs of treated stud tail at the base. Superb temperament, excellent presentation. Sorry not to award the certificate, but for me he lacks extra needed at this level. Of course, he is very young and could improve.

Siamese/Balinese Grand Champion, Female

IGCC Cook's GR CH JOHPAS MIZMIXTURE (32b2) 14 Jul 10
A wonderful girl of exquisite type - my first meeting with her, but worth the wait - still only young, but very much the finished article. Long even wedge, good width at the top. well set large ears. Profile almost straight, chin firm but slightly shallow, level bite. Expressive eyes of excellent shape and set and of a very good deep blue. Long firm relaxed body, long legs with neat paws, balancing length of tail. Points of a good blue mingled with shades of cool cream - quite sparsely mingled, I have to admit - lightly shaded body, close coat of excellent texture. Wonderful temperament, excellent presentation. My clear choice for overall best exhibit, though the rest of the panel thought otherwise

Pointed Oriental Bicolour Premier, Male

GPC Taylor's PR JADEVYN BRYCHAN TROEDMAWR (48 40bt) 19 May 08
A lad of superior type, though a lack of self-confidence made the fact quite difficult to discern, but as he relaxed he improved out of all recognition. Longish even wedge, good width at the top, well set large ears. Profile straight other than a bump on the nose, very firm slightly shallow chin, level bite. Eyes of good shape and set and of good depth of blue for a bicolour considering the placement of the white on his face. Long well fed body, long legs with neat paws, balancing length of tail. White to almost the complete underside, inverted V in the mask, white tips to the ears, for most of the front limbs and over the shoulders, rear paws and some on the right thigh, a small patch on the back, all in all a little over the required third. Coloured areas well marked in darkish warm chocolate, moderate shading on the body. Coat close and of good texture. Excellent temperament and presentation.

Chocolate Point Kitten, Female

1 (BOB N/A) Harrison's MAIHONGSONG SUZI-WONG (24b) 27 Jun 11
A very friendly kitten of reasonably good type. Medium length wedge, a little short in the muzzle, needing more width at the top; large ears set in line. Straight profile, firm chin and level bite. Eyes of good shape and set needing more depth of blue. Proportionate firm body, long legs with tiny paws, balancing length of tail. Points a distinctly dark chocolate where they have developed, though quite warm in tone, all rather brindled. Unshaded body, coat close and of good texture. Excellent temperament and presentation.

Apricot Point Adult, Male

1+CC+BOB Bunyan's LAZIZA TEPPANYAKI 18 Dec 10
An impressive lad, handsome and very mature for his age, of very good type. Long even wedge, good width at the top, well set large ears. Straight profile, firm chin and level bite. Eyes of very good shape and set and good depth of blue. Long firm muscular body, long legs with neat paws, tail needs an extra fraction to balance. Colour a good warm sludgy apricot. Moderately shaded body, close coat of excellent texture. Superb temperament, excellent presentation.

Balinese Neuter, Male

BOB Woodhouse's GR PR DORAL LEBRUIN (61fnt) 12 Dec 09
A handsome large lad of very good type. Longish even wedge, good width at the top, well set ears which would ideally be a touch bigger. Profile almost straight apart from a bump on the nose, firm chin, level bite lacking the lower incisors. Eyes of good shape and set though a little deep set, of good depth of blue. Long firm body, long legs with large paws, tail needs an extra inch to balance. Coat frilling a little round the neck, of adequate length to the back and upper sides, good length elsewhere and of an excellent texture. Good furnishings to feet and ears, good plume. Marked in a slightly pale but very warm apricot, good facial markings and tail rings, leg bars there but faint. Moderately shaded body. Excellent temperament and presentation.
